Transaction e2927188f20f69bf867535134ec1d9b55096d735644ee26fafb7b77f16679259

1 Input
2 Outputs
  • e2927188f20f69bf867535134ec1d9b55096d735644ee26fafb7b77f16679259:0
  • value  3000000
    address  3EsdLuGZH1jSheBiiGixL4xFBEohtwvxmW
  • e2927188f20f69bf867535134ec1d9b55096d735644ee26fafb7b77f16679259:1
  • value  34566067
    address  16KCymJuTFcQBBCWP8hKUg3hPWsLpuEZrx